Relationship with other publications This standard is the first in a series of “daughter” standards of BS 8900, Guidance for managing sustainable developme
21、nt. As a “derivative” of BS 8900, this standard has been written in such a way as to reflect the spirit of BS 8900. Consequently the principles described in the standard are designed to be compatible with BS 8900. However, whereas BS 8900 has the broadest application to organizations and is independ
22、ent of the nature of their activities, this standard focuses more specifically on organizations engaged in the event industry. This standard also shares common management system principles with the ISO 9000 and ISO 14000 series. The following table shows the commonality between BS 8900, BS 8901, BS
23、EN ISO 9001 and BS EN ISO 14001. Standard Application Topic Design element Standard type BS 8900 General Sustainability Sustainable development Guide BS 8901 Events only Sustainability Sustainable development Management system specification BS EN ISO 9001 General Quality Customer satisfaction Manage
24、ment system specification BS EN ISO 14001 General Environment Environmental impact Management system specification There is an important distinction between this standard and BS 8900. BS 8900 takes the form of guidance and recommendation but is not a specification to which compliance can be claimed
